Bandits in disarray

On Friday, December 20, 2024, the Motorized Intervention Brigades Corps (CBIM) repelled an attack by the coalition of gangs of the "Viv Ansanm" coalition against the CBIM base in Clercine. The armed bandits retreated in the face of the firepower of the CBIM agents. No police officers were injured and the area was secured.

Petite Rivière : The PNH regains territory

Agents from specialized PNH units and members of the multinational mission dislodged the bandits and regained control of Palmiste, Ducasse and Marcaisse, three localities in the 2nd communal section of Petite Rivière de l'Artibonite. More than 16 armed bandits, identified as members of the "Gran Grif" gang, were killed in exchanges of fire with the police, others, some of them wounded, took refuge in Savien.

Former Ambassador Foley advocates for American intervention

Former U.S. Ambassador to Haiti, James B. Foley, continues to advocate for U.S. military intervention in Haiti. "A Trump-ordered intervention to save the population will be brief, successful and applauded," Foley said in an op-ed published in the Miami Herald.

PNH : 1.9 billion for debit cards

Following the recent announcement by Prime Minister Alix Didier Fils-Aimé in recognition of the sacrifices of the police officers, mobilized on all fronts, to double the amount of the police debit card which goes from 15,000 to 30,000 Gourdes monthly starting this December, Alfred Métellus, the Minister of Economy and Finance confirmed that an envelope of 1.9 billion Gourdes on an annual basis, or approximately 158 million Gourdes per month had been mobilized for this purpose. The Minister specified that this measure was permanent and definitive.

Diaspora : Fruitful meeting between the MHAVE and the National Archives

During a first meeting between J.E Kathia Verdier, the Minister of Haitians Living Abroad (MHAVE) and Wilfrid Bertrand, the Director of the National Archives of Haiti (ANH). At the end of this meeting, it was agreed to sign a Memorandum of Understanding to conduct joint actions for the issuance of extracts from civil status records; launch a pilot action in Chile and Brazil, where the demand for extracts from archives is particularly high and develop a timetable to extend this initiative to other countries with similar needs.

Bilateral Council of Ministers Colombia-Haiti

Leslie Voltaire President pro Tempore of the Transitional Council at the head of a delegation of 9 people including 6 ministers, leaves the country this Saturday, December 21 for Colombia to participate in a Bilateral Council of Ministers Colombia-Haiti. According to the Prime Minister's Office, this bilateral Council of Ministers aims to promote "cooperation between Haiti and Colombia and to facilitate bilateral exchanges in the areas of tourism, trade, security, education and humanitarianism, among others [...]"
